A recent perusal of MiniWorld with some colleagues, who work on other Kelsey Media titles, came up with a few keywords to describe the mag's content. One word that kept coming up was 'family'. Of course I was delighted as, to me, family is key to the Mini community. It's not unusual to find
generations of Mini fans, or a child who is restoring a Mini with a parent, or a family group camping at a Mini show. For those who have grown up with Minis then the cars themselves become part of the family. Even being part of a Mini club can be like gaining new relatives of all ages. The owner of this issue's cover car, Lucy MacKenzie, has fond memories of her mother's Mini Cooper, as well as some that are not so fond, and chose to get the Mini restored so that she and husband William can enjoy many adventures with it for years to come. To continue with the family theme, check out our interview with the Mylchreest family, Mini fans who owned dealerships selling Minis on the Isle of Man from 1959 to 2000. Don't miss Tim Mundy's article on preparing a Mini workshop and see the progress on our project cars. There are also some more fantastic feature Minis including Aidan McGrath's Suzuki-engined 1275GT, Martin Ridge's fab Pick-up and Shoichiro Nagai’s injection Rover Mini – his father and son project didn't work out quite as he'd planned... As the weather grew hotter in June and July, many people headed for Mini and classic car events so see if your Mini was photographed by us in the show review section, which starts on page 96. I hope you enjoy the issue.

MiniWorld is the original and best-selling magazine for the Mini. It’s jam-packed with the best modified Minis in the world, from full-on custom cars to beautiful restorations. There’s news, club info and technical features, plus our huge classified section can get you on the road to enjoying the brilliant Mini scene.
